May candidates and issues slated for Fayette County Chamber of Commerce breakfast

0

If you want to familiarize yourself with the candidates and issues on the primary/special election ballot May 2, the Fayette County Chamber of Commerce will have them all in one place at its April 11 “Ballot Breakast.”

The event is free to chamber members and $5 per person for non-members, and will take place at Southern State Community College’s Community Room, 1270 US Highway 62 SW. The buffet line, catered by Rachel’s House, will open at 7:15 a.m. and the program will begin at 7:30 a.m.

Candidates and issues represented will include:

• Washington Municipal Court Judge candidates: Victor Pontious and Susan Wollscheid

• Miami Trace Local Schools’ operating renewal: David Lewis, superintendent

• Village of New Holland operating issue: “Butch” Betzko, mayor

• Union Township renewal levy: Clyde Fyffe, Union Township Trustee

• Paint Valley Mental Health & Prevention levy: Penny Dehner, associate director
